Transaction 58e782d373a727dfea4d4e47acd07dc93576aefd62f0fccaedb46cda1b735689
1 Input
2 Outputs
- 58e782d373a727dfea4d4e47acd07dc93576aefd62f0fccaedb46cda1b735689:0
- 58e782d373a727dfea4d4e47acd07dc93576aefd62f0fccaedb46cda1b735689:1
value 9063376
address 17HPndxHs7ALGoVC1N1GHepav6pwiTjB3o
value 14674330
address 3QGwdouN26LQwuHdncJ2vHbMGgMFjqiMo3